摘要: 原文出处: Hosee 在学校期间大家都写过不少程序,比如写个hello world服务类,然后本地调用下,如下所示。这些程序的特点是服务消费方和服务提供方是本地调用关系。 1 2 3 4 5 6 public class Test { public static void main(String[ 阅读全文
posted @ 2018-05-07 02:28 SessionBest 阅读(592) 评论(0) 推荐(0) 编辑
摘要: 实现堆排序的算法思路是先创建堆,也就是从叶子节点起对每一层的孩子节点及其对应位置的父亲节点进行比较,较大的孩子节点替换较小的父亲节点,一级一级比较替换,就创建出了大根堆,小根堆反之。创建好大根堆以后,我们,将整棵树的根节点与最后最后一个节点替换位置,然后去除最后一个节点,在创建一个新的大根堆,以此类 阅读全文
posted @ 2018-05-05 21:05 SessionBest 阅读(396) 评论(0) 推荐(0) 编辑
摘要: 目录 目录 Heap是一种数据结构具有以下的特点: 1)完全二叉树; 2)heap中存储的值是偏序; Min-heap: 父节点的值小于或等于子节点的值; Max-heap: 父节点的值大于或等于子节点的值; 堆的存储: 一般都用数组来表示堆,i结点的父结点下标就为(i–1)/2。它的左右子结点下标 阅读全文
posted @ 2018-05-05 21:03 SessionBest 阅读(724) 评论(0) 推荐(0) 编辑
摘要: 先看下Spring的 事务传播行为类型 事务传播行为类型 说明 PROPAGATION_REQUIRED 如果当前没有事务,就新建一个事务,如果已经存在一个事务中,加入到这个事务中。这是 最常见的选择。 PROPAGATION_SUPPORTS 支持当前事务,如果当前没有事务,就以非事务方式执行。 阅读全文
posted @ 2018-04-11 23:24 SessionBest 阅读(237) 评论(0) 推荐(0) 编辑
摘要: 版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/guyuealian/article/details/51119499 版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/guyuealian/artic 阅读全文
posted @ 2018-04-03 13:09 SessionBest 阅读(274) 评论(0) 推荐(0) 编辑
摘要: 死锁的定义> 如果一组进程中的每一个进程都在等待仅由该组进程中的其他进程才能引发的事件,那仫该组进程就是死锁的. 产生死锁的必要条件> 1).互斥条件:进程对所分配到的资源进行排它性使用,即在一段时间内,某资源只能被一个进程占用。如果此时还有其他进程请求该资源,则请求资源只能等待,直至占有该资源的进 阅读全文
posted @ 2018-04-03 09:57 SessionBest 阅读(10015) 评论(1) 推荐(0) 编辑
摘要: String是所有语言中最常用的一个类。我们知道在Java中,String是不可变的、final的。Java在运行时也保存了一个字符串池(String pool),这使得String成为了一个特别的类。 主要是为了 “ 效率 ” 和 “ 安全性 ” 的缘故。 若 String 允许被继承, 由于它的 阅读全文
posted @ 2018-04-02 23:09 SessionBest 阅读(532) 评论(0) 推荐(0) 编辑
摘要: 一、概述: 1、什么是双向链表: 链表中的每个节点即指向前面一个节点,也指向后面一个节点,就像丢手绢游戏一样,每个人都手拉手 2、从头部插入 要对链表进行判断,如果为空则设置尾节点为新添加的节点,如果不为空,还要设置头节点的一个前节点为新节点 3、从尾部进行插入 如果链表为空,则直接设置头节点为新添 阅读全文
posted @ 2018-04-02 16:00 SessionBest 阅读(229) 评论(0) 推荐(0) 编辑
摘要: package com.session.link;/** * 单向链表 */public class LinkedList<T> { private Node head;//指向链表头节点的引用变量 private Node tail;//指向链表尾节点的引用变量 int size;//链表中当前总 阅读全文
posted @ 2018-04-02 14:25 SessionBest 阅读(452) 评论(0) 推荐(0) 编辑
摘要: package com.session.chop;import java.util.Arrays;/** * 二分查找 */public class BinarySearch { public static void main(String[] args) { int[] array = new i 阅读全文
posted @ 2018-04-02 14:24 SessionBest 阅读(96) 评论(0) 推荐(0) 编辑